There is a significant gap in the cost of living between these two cities. Little Creek is 23.9% cheaper than Odessa. With a cost index of 80 vs 106, the difference would have a meaningful impact on a household's monthly budget. Someone relocating from Little Creek to Odessa should plan for substantially higher expenses across most categories.

On the housing front, median rent in Little Creek is $1,108/month compared to $1,344/month in Odessa — a 18%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Little Creek is more affordable at $178,600 median vs $355,000.

Median household income in Little Creek is $70,179 compared to $86,875 in Odessa (-19.2%). The higher salaries in Odessa partially offset the cost difference, but don't fully close the gap. Looking at affordability, residents of Little Creek spend roughly 18.9% of their income on rent, more than the 18.6% in Odessa.
